Zebeta: Essential Insights

Characteristic Details
Generic Name Bisoprolol
Dosage Form Oral tablets
Available Strengths 5 mg, 10 mg
Mechanism of Action Beta-1 adrenergic blocker
Manufacturer Merck & Co.

What is Zebeta?

Zebeta, known generically as Bisoprolol, is a medication predominantly used in the management of cardiovascular conditions. This drug belongs to the class of beta-blockers, which function by reducing the workload on the heart and helping it beat more regularly. Bisoprolol is formulated as an oral tablet and comes in various dosages, including Zebeta 5 mg and 10 mg. Its pharmacological action focuses on blocking beta-1 adrenergic receptors, primarily found in cardiac tissue, reducing heart rate and blood pressure.

Clinical use of Bisoprolol is widespread, especially in patients with chronic heart failure and hypertension. By mitigating the effects of adrenaline on the heart, it improves cardiac efficiency and oxygen consumption. The comprehensive role of this medication makes it a cornerstone in therapy for heart-related ailments. Despite its effectiveness, it is essential for healthcare providers to assess patient history and concurrent conditions to optimize treatment outcomes.

Zebeta Use

Therapeutic applications of Zebeta span several heart-related conditions. Primarily, it addresses hypertension, a significant risk factor for cardiovascular morbidity. By reducing systemic vascular resistance, it aids in lowering elevated blood pressure. This intervention helps prevent long-term complications such as stroke and myocardial infarction.

In addition to hypertension, Bisoprolol is employed in managing chronic heart failure. For patients exhibiting systolic dysfunction, Bisoprolol enhances heart contractility and reduces hospitalization rates. It’s critical for individuals to follow the prescribed dosing schedule to ensure maximal efficacy and minimize adverse effects.

FDA-Approved Indications

The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has sanctioned the use of Zebeta for specific conditions. These include treatment of hypertension and management of chronic heart failure. Its use is approved based on robust clinical data supporting its safety and effectiveness in reducing cardiovascular events.

Off-label use of Bisoprolol may extend to arrhythmias, although primary approval focuses on heart failure and high blood pressure. Patients prescribed Zebeta should adhere to guidelines provided by their healthcare professional to maintain therapeutic benefit.

Zebeta Storage

Appropriate storage conditions are imperative for maintaining the stability and efficacy of Zebeta. Tablets should be kept at room temperature, away from excessive moisture and light. A cool, dry place is ideal to prevent degradation.

Patients should ensure that the medication is stored in its original packaging to avoid contamination. Keeping Zebeta out of reach of children is crucial, as accidental ingestion can lead to serious complications. Monitoring the expiration date is also essential to prevent administration of expired medication.

Zebeta Side Effects

Like any medication, Zebeta may cause side effects, although not everyone experiences them. Common adverse effects include fatigue, dizziness, and headache. These symptoms often resolve as the body acclimates to the drug.

Severe side effects may occur, such as bradycardia or hypotension. Patients should be vigilant for symptoms such as shortness of breath or unusual swelling. Medical attention should be sought promptly if severe reactions develop.

  • Fatigue
  • Dizziness
  • Headache

Healthcare providers should be informed of all side effects to adjust treatment plans as necessary. The balance between therapeutic benefit and side effect risk is essential for effective management.

Zebeta Over The Counter

Zebeta is not available over the counter. It requires a prescription due to its specific indications and potential for adverse reactions. A healthcare provider’s assessment is necessary to determine suitability and correct dosing.

Patients are advised to consult their doctor or pharmacist for comprehensive information about Zebeta. Unauthorized use can lead to significant health risks. Professional guidance ensures safe and effective use tailored to individual health needs.
